Lois Henigan Reid, 99, wife of the late Dr. Joe W. Reid, died in her sleep, Thursday, Feb. 18, 2010.  The daughter of Denis Oren and Annabelle Hinkson Henigan she was born Sept. 26, 1910 in Little Rock.
 After their marriage in 1932 the Reids lived in Atlanta, Geo., where he was an intern at Grady Memorial Hospital.  In 1934 they moved to Wartburg, Tenn., for a year of service in the Civilian Conservation Corps.  In 1935 the Reid’s moved to Arkadelphia,  where Dr. Reid set up his medical practice and Lois became active in the community and the First Presbyterian Church.  She lived on Hickory Street until 2001 when she moved to Greenville, S.C.
 Surviving are daughters Anna Kate Hipp and her husband, Hayne, of Greenville, S.C. and Elese Reid of Manhattan, N.Y.  Other survivors include grandchildren, Mary Henigan Hipp of Greenville, Francis Reid Hipp and his wife, Brice, of Greenville,  Anna Hayne (Tres) Small and her husband Robert of Athens, Ga., and great grandchildren Camilla, Hayne and Reid Hipp and Hannah and Clara Small.
